Δημοσιεύτηκε: 29 Οκτ 2011, 12:31
από pmav99
Έγραψα ένα script σε python3

Αρχικά άνοιξα το αρχείο και εκτύπωσα μέσα από την python το περιεχόμενο του για να δω ποιοι χαρακτήρες είναι:
Κώδικας: Επιλογή όλων
with open("standard.dic", "r") as f:
text = text.read()
print(a)
Αφού είδα το κείμενο, είδα ότι οι εν λόγω χαρακτήρες είναι οι ακόλουθοι:
Κώδικας: Επιλογή όλων
"\x00", "\x01", ... "\x0f",
"\x10", "\x11", ... "\x1f"
+ μερικοί ακόμα που δεν τους θυμάμαι τώρα.Στη συνέχιεα αντικατέστησα τους χαρακτήρες αυτούς με χαρακτήρες κενού
Κώδικας: Επιλογή όλων
for char in ["\x00", "\x01"...]:
text = text.replace(char, " ")

Αφαίρεσα μετά τις κενές γραμμές και έγραψα το αποτέλεσμα σε ένα καινούριο αρχείο.

Η μέθοδος φυσικά δεν είναι στάνταρ, αλλά δε χάνεις τίποτα να δοκιμάσεις.